9 Days Private Tour Chengdu – Dujiangyan – Panda in Wolong – Siguniang Shan Town – Danba – Bamei – Tagong – Xinduqiao – Yajiang – Litang – Yajiang – Kangding – Luding – Yaan – Shangli - Dayi - Chengdu
On this trip, we will enjoy the leisure life in Chengdu firstly. Then we will departure to Tibetan Area Kham in west Sichuan, visiting the irrigation project in Dujiangyan and pandas in Wolong - the first panda reserve in China. Cross over Balang Mountain, visit Siguniang Mountain, and enter the most beautiful village in China – the Jiaju Tibetan Village in Danba, where Jiarong Tibetans live. Afterwards go to Tagong, which is “the Buddha's favorite place” and is also reputed as “Little Lhasa”. Following Khampa Tibetan, we turn the prayer wheel of Tagong Monastery and listen to their sounds of reading in the Gyergo Nunnery. Walk onto the hillside by the Muya Golden Pagoda and wait for the sunrise and sunset of Holy Mountain Yala. Afterwards drive to Litang which is known as "world highland city" with an altitude of 4014 m above sea level. Litang is the homeland of 7th Dalai Lama, and it has always been the cultural center of Kham.

In late July or early August, a grand horse racing festival will be held in Litang. Khampa Tibetans from all over the Tibetan Plateau come to ride, trade, celebrate, dance and sing. Let us immerse ourselves in it too!

On the way back to Chengdu, we will visit Luding Iron Chain Bridge where the Chinese Red Army combated during the Long March.

27.07.2021 Arrive in Chengdu

Enjoy Chengdu leisurely daily life, Kuanzai Xiangzi, drink tea in People’s Park

In the morning arrival in Chengdu, the capital of Sichuan province, home town of giant panda. Picked up by the local guide at airport and transfer to hotel. In the afternoon stroll in the beautiful old block of Chengdu - Wide Alley and Narrow Alley (Kuan Xiangzi and Zhai Xiangzi), they are the relics of the Manchurian garrison since 1718 and consist of 3 parallel lanes with the old classical houses, which are unique in southern China just like the northern Chinese architectural style presented by Hutong. After a careful renovation in June 2008, the pubs, teahouses, restaurants and guesthouses concentrate here, and in no time at all, it becomes the "lobby of leisure capital Chengdu". A walk here gives you a first impression of the "city of loafers". Then visit the People’s Park in the city center, have a seat in an old teahouse, enjoy your covered-bowl tea in a comfortable environment with bamboo chair and bamboo table, the tea culture of Chengdu is well known throughout China.

28.07.2021 Chengdu - Dujiangyang - Wolong - Siguniang Shan Town

Dujiangyan Irrigation System, Wolong National Nature Reserve, Shenshuping Panda Base, Sunset of Mt. Siguniangshan

In the morning drive to Dujiangyan to visit the Irrigation System, which was built around 250 BC by Li Bin, a governor of Shu Prefecture in Qin State. The great project still works well today after more than two thousand year’s function, which not only puts an end of the water disaster to the local people but also makes Chengdu Plain “the land of abundance”. While visiting the water conservation work, you may find that the methods of harnessing the river the ancient people used are so simple but useful. In 2000, Dujiangyan became a UNESCO World Heritage Site. After that drive to Wolong National Nature Reserve. 52 km long from east to west and 62 km wide from south to north, the whole area is 200,000 hm². It is one of the China earliest natural reverses, which is rated the preservation zones network of “mankind and living beings” by the Organization of Education, Science and Culture of United Nations (UNESCO). The virgin forest, second bush forest and bamboo groves are very green. There are over 4,000 kinds of high-level plants, 24 kinds of them are valuable plants, such as Gongtong (Chinese dove tree), red China fir, Lianxiang and so on. There are more than 450 kinds of vertebras, 45 kinds of them are rated national focal preserved animals, such as giant panda, golden monkeys, antelopes, white-mouth deer etc. The natural beautiful scene is quiet and secluded. Visit Shenshuping Panda Base in Wolong, about 50 pandas live here, it is the largest breeding center for giant pandas, integrating scientific research, feeding, breeding, reproduction, wildness training, etc. Then drive to Siguniang Shan Town (former Rilong) through the Balang Tunnel, if the weather is good, enjoy the beautiful landscape of sunset of Siguniang Shan Mountain at the Maobiliang.

29.07.2021 Siguniang Shan Town – Danba

Sunrise of Mt. Siguniang, Shuangqiao Valley, Wori Tusi Manor, Tibetan village Jiaju

If the weather is good, you’ll get early to enjoy the great panoramic view of Mt. Siguniang (Four Sisters Mountain) at Maobiliang at sunrise. And then visit and walking in the Shuangqiao Valley in the Siguniang Mountain. Afterwards drive to visit Wori Tusi Manor, the former official residence of the local Tusi, a kind of imperial kingship leader. After that drive to visit Tibetan village Jiaju, the most beautiful village of China. In Danba, the local people are called Jiarong (Gyarong) Tibetans. Walking and visit in the Jiaju village. More than one hundred buildings keep the same architectural style with a complete and unique character of Jiarong Tibetan residences. Under the blue sky, the Tibetan residences decorated in red, white and black are strewed at random but also in school from the bottom to the middle slope of the valley.

30.07.2021 Danba - Bamei – Tagong

Block towers in Suopo, Huiyuan Temple, Lhagang Monastery, Gyergo Nunnery and the grand mani wall of Hepingfahui, sunset of Yala Mountain

Danba has long been acclaimed as the Kingdom of Thousands of Ancient Blockhouses. In the morning visit the ancient block towers in Suopo. They were made of clay and block and look fine from outside with solid thick walls. Then drive to Bamei, on the way visit the Huiyuan Temple and the beautiful villages. Upon arrival at Tagong, visit the Lhagang Monastery (Tagong Si) of Sayka Sect, which is surrounded by three hills symbolizing three Bodhisattvas. Then visit the impressive Gyergo Nunnery and the grand mani wall of Hepingfahui. If the weather is good, enjoy the beautiful landscape of sunset of Yala Mountain.

31.07.2021 Tagong - Xinduqiao – Yajiang - Litang

Sunset of Yala Mountain, Litang Si monastery

If the weather is good, enjoy the beautiful landscape of sunset of Yala Mountain. You’ll drive on the zigzag road up to the mountain chain of Hengduanshan (Mt. Blocks), which extends from the north to the south. Short photo break at Xinduqiao, the “Paradise of Photographers”, a small town on the road juncture where the northern route of Sichuan-Tibet Highway (Chengdu - Lhasa) and the southern route of Sichuan-Tibet Highway (Chengdu - Lhasa) meet. When the weather is good, you can see the main peak of Gongga Mountain (7556 m, Minya Konka, “the King Peak of Sichuan”) from Xinduqiao. Keep driving southwards to Yajiang and enter the Yalong river ravine. In the afternoon arrival in the “world highland city" Litang (4014 m) which is the homeland 7th Dalai Lama. Upon arrival, visit Changqingchunke'er Monastery (also admits as Litang Si monastery) in the western suburb. The Litang Monastery, developed by the 3.th Dalai Lama in the year 1580, today, became the largest monastery of the Gelukpa Sect in south Kham.

01.08.2021 Litang

Litang Horse Racing Festival (Nomads Festival)

The whole day take part in the Litang Horse Racing Festival, which will be held on the first of August and lasts about 7 days. Currently the traditional festival has further developed. Besides the traditional horseracing, other activities like horsemanship, singing, dancing, national costume show, etc. have become part of the grand festival. Large-scale material exchange also takes place during the festival.

03.08.2021 Yajiang - Kangding - Luding – Yaan

Sunset of Yala Mountain, Zheduo Shan Pass (4298 m), Luding Bridge

Cross over Zheduo Shan Pass (4298 m) to Kangding, the capital of Ganzi Tibetan Autonomous Prefecture and the important juncture of Tibetan and Han People in history. Keep driving to Luding and crossing through the 4.1 km long tunnel of Mt. Erlang Shan to Yaan, the famous rainy city. In Luding visit the Luding Chain Bridge (Iron Chain Bridge) on the Dadu River, which is a treasure of Chinese ancient architecture. The bridge was built in the 44th year of Kangxi in the Qing Dynasty (1705) in order to enhance the connection with Tibetan culture. On May 29th, 1935, the Chinese Red Army reached Luding Bridge during the Long March. Facing a hail of bullets, the Chinese Red Army, with 22 warriors as the pioneers of the commando, destroyed the bridge’s guards in one fell swoop, which is an important historical monument of the Communist Party of China.

04.08.2021 Yaan – Dayi - Chengdu

Shangli Ancient Town. Travel to next destination

In the morning visit the Shangli Ancient Town. Old Town Shangli is called an “Ink and Wash Landscape” painting. Situated in the Western Sichuan Basin, the town was once the important post on the Silk Road of the South and the Ancient Tea-Horse Trail in history. In the afternoon drive via Dayi back to Chengdu, transfer to airport or railway station, leave Chengdu.

We must point out that you counter a basic tourism infrastructure in this region. You stay overnight mostly at simple hotel/guesthouse. Long journeys on bad roads and on high altitude and delays require good physical fitness, resilience and flexibility of the participants. Program and route changes due to unforeseen events are expressly reserved. If you desire the unknown and have an understanding of contingency, this is the right trip for you.
